How to Interpret Sports Betting Lines
Sports betting lines can appear complex at first, but they essentially summarize the likelihood of each outcome. For example, a betting line showing +200 for a team indicates that a successful $100 bet would yield $200 in profit, while a -150 line indicates that one must wager $150 to win $100. Understanding these lines helps bettors create a strategy that maximizes potential returns.

Types of Bets Available
Understanding Spread Bets
Spread betting is a common form of wagering that levels the playing field between two unevenly matched teams. The sportsbook establishes a line (the spread) that a favored team must cover. For example, if Team A is favored to win by seven points, they must win by more than that margin for the bet to succeed.
Exploring Over/Under Bets
Over/under bets allow bettors to wager on the total number of points scored in a game rather than focusing solely on the outcome. For example, if the over/under line is set at 45, a bettor can wager on whether the total points will be over or under that number. This type of bet encourages gamblers to consider the scoring potential of both teams and their offensive/defensive capabilities.
Analyzing Moneyline Bets
Moneyline betting is a straightforward way to bet on the outcome of a game. With moneyline bets, bettors select which team they believe will win outright, regardless of the score margin. The odds reflect the perceived probability of each team’s success. A team with negative odds indicates a favorite, while positive odds denote an underdog. Understanding the implications of these odds is vital for effective moneyline betting.
